Dry cabins by capacity
| Item | Price (IDR) | Lead time |
|---|---|---|
| 2 people, 1.5×1.2 m, pinewood, 3.6 kW, 5,500 VA | IDR 55–70 million | 2–3 weeks |
| 4 people, 2×2 m, red cedar, 6 kW, 7,700 VA | IDR 75–95 million | 2–4 weeks |
| 6 people, 2.4×2 m, thermowood, 8 kW, 11,000 VA | IDR 110–150 million | 3–4 weeks |
| 8 people, 3×2.4 m, 9 kW, 11,000 VA | IDR 150–200 million | 3–4 weeks |
| 10 people, 3.5×2.6 m, 10.5 kW, three phase | IDR 190–240 million | 4–6 weeks |
| 12 people, 4×3 m, 12 kW, three phase | IDR 230–290 million | 4–8 weeks |
Prices are indicative; a fixed quote follows the free survey.
What moves a Malang quote up or down?
Species does most of the work. Pinewood anchors the bottom of a band, red cedar the middle, thermowood and figured cedar the top, and on a 2×2 m cabin those choices sit thirty million rupiah apart. Glass comes next: one viewing panel is cheap, a full glazed front is not, and a frameless glazed corner is really a different cabin on the same footprint.
Then comes the meter. An Araya cluster house that already reads 7,700 VA needs wiring and nothing else. A house near Ijen on 2,200 VA needs a PLN change of capacity — paid by the owner — and often a long run from a consumer unit at the far end of the building. Guesthouses in Batu that already have three phase can take a larger cabin for no extra electrical work at all.
Access is the fourth factor and the one most often forgotten. A Blimbing ground-floor room a van can park beside is quick. A terrace in Bumiaji reached by ninety metres of footpath is not, and the handling days show as their own line rather than disappearing into a rounded-up total. Distance itself is not charged: a survey is free anywhere from Klojen to Pujon.
Monthly cost once it is installed
For three or four sessions a week: a dry cabin costs IDR 200,000–500,000 a month, infrared IDR 100,000–250,000, a steam room IDR 300,000–600,000 and a cold plunge IDR 300,000–700,000. Malang's cool nights help on both ends — cabins lose less heat than on the coast, and plunge chillers cycle less often.
Consumables are small but real: sauna stones every few years, a generator flush on schedule with a softener if your water is hard, filter cartridges and an ozone or UV lamp for the plunge. Reckon on a couple of million rupiah a year for a timber cabin, and a good deal more for a tiled one.
Warranty covers the structure for two years. Heaters and generators keep their factory cover of 1–2 years, and because we stock Harvia, Sawo and Tylö spares in Indonesia a failed element is a short wait rather than an import order.
Frequently asked questions
Why is there no fixed price on the site?
Because two rooms of the same size can differ by forty per cent once timber, glazing, meter capacity and access are known. Publishing bands and then quoting exactly after a survey is more useful than a single number that changes on the first visit.
Is a build in Batu more expensive than one in Kota Malang?
Not for the cabin itself. What can differ is handling where a van cannot reach, plus roofing and decking on an outdoor unit. Travel to Batu, Pujon or Lawang is not charged as a separate item.
How does payment work?
Fifty per cent deposit when the quote is signed, the balance before installation begins, then handover once the heat test is done. The figure holds unless the specification itself changes.
Can I get a figure before booking a survey?
Yes. Room dimensions plus a photograph of the PLN meter, sent from the contact page, are enough for an indicative band on the same working day.
